Old parish church of St.  Ulrich and cemetery
Upload file
Old parish church of St. Ulrich and Friedhof ObjectID
65722
Dr.-A.-Heinzle-Straße 36 KG
location
: Götzis
During excavations, the cemetery was expanded in 1875, the floor plan of a choir tower church was excavated. During excavations (1980) the foundation of the tower from 1340 was found. The church was enlarged around 1509 and rededicated in 1514. From 1974 to 1981 the church was restored. The church shows extensive wall paintings.

Catholic branch church hl.  Arbogast
Upload file
Catholic branch church hl. Arbogast ObjectID
65564
Montfortstrasse 81 KG
location
: Götzis
The chapel, mentioned in a document as early as 1473, was enlarged around 1710 and consecrated in 1721. The tall tower with a gabled spire is attached to the nave and the strongly recessed choir in the north and the sacristy and a chapel in the south. The high altar with renaissance-like structure, pictures and figures dates from after 1650. In the vestibule, paintings by Leonhard Werder from 1659 show the Arboga legend .
Ansitz, Sonderberg Upload file Ansitz, Sonderberg ObjektID
31049
Sonderberg 43 KG
location
: Götzis
The residence on the southern roof of the Sonderberg was built by Canon Dr. Friedrich Sandholzer built. It has been owned by farmers since 1710. Since the demolition of the east wing at the beginning of the 19th century, only the south wing, which was later extended to the west, has survived: a three-storey tower-like building with rectangular windows in wood or stone frames.
